.bdb-tabs[data-v-6e12c940] {
  list-style-type: none;
  display: flex;
  gap: var(--bdb-tab-gap);
  height: var(--bdb-tab-height);
  line-height: var(--bdb-tab-height);
}
.bdb-tabs .bdb-tab-item[data-v-6e12c940] {
  font-family: "Alibaba PuHuiTi 2.0";
  font-weight: 400;
  font-size: 0.08333333rem;
  color: #bfbfbf;
  cursor: pointer;
  transition: color 0.3s;
  text-align: center;
  position: relative;
  padding: 0 0.078125rem;
}
.bdb-tabs .bdb-tab-item[data-v-6e12c940]::after {
  content: "";
  display: block;
  position: absolute;
  left: 50%;
  bottom: 0.01041667rem;
  transform: translateX(-50%);
  width: 100%;
  height: 0.01041667rem;
  background: linear-gradient(90deg, #7b4aff, #2991f1);
  opacity: 0;
  transition: opacity 0.3s;
  border-radius: 0.00520833rem;
  pointer-events: none;
}
.bdb-tabs .bdb-tab-item[data-v-6e12c940]:hover {
  color: #ffffff;
}
.bdb-tabs .bdb-tab-item.is-active[data-v-6e12c940] {
  color: #ffffff;
}
.bdb-tabs .bdb-tab-item.is-active[data-v-6e12c940]::after {
  opacity: 1;
}
.bdb-tabs .bdb-tab-item.is-disabled[data-v-6e12c940] {
  color: #868686;
  cursor: not-allowed;
}
.bdb-button[data-v-3f310198] {
  display: flex;
  align-items: center;
  justify-content: center;
  gap: 0.04166667rem;
  border-radius: 0.04166667rem;
  transition: 0.3s;
  cursor: pointer;
  color: #ffffff;
  font-weight: 400;
  position: relative;
}
.bdb-button i[data-v-3f310198] {
  font-size: 0.07291667rem;
}
.bdb-button .mask[data-v-3f310198] {
  position: absolute;
  left: 0;
  top: 0;
  width: 100%;
  height: 100%;
  background: rgba(255, 255, 255, 0.3);
}
.bdb-button img[data-v-3f310198] {
  width: 0.09375rem;
  height: 0.09375rem;
}
.bdb-button.is-disabled[data-v-3f310198] {
  cursor: not-allowed;
}
.bdb-button--default[data-v-3f310198] {
  padding: 0.05208333rem 0.10416667rem;
  color: #bfbfbf;
  border: 0.00520833rem solid transparent;
  background-clip: padding-box, border-box;
  background-origin: padding-box, border-box;
  background-image: linear-gradient(0deg, #1e1e1d, #1e1e1d), linear-gradient(270deg, #2991f1, #7b4aff);
}
.bdb-button--default.is-disabled[data-v-3f310198] {
  background: #8c8c8c;
}
.bdb-button--default[data-v-3f310198]:not(.is-disabled):hover {
  background-color: #242424;
  color: #fff;
}
.bdb-button--primary[data-v-3f310198] {
  background: linear-gradient(90deg, #7b4aff 0%, #2991f1 100%);
  padding: 0.05729167rem 0.10416667rem;
  border: none;
}
.bdb-button--primary[data-v-3f310198]:not(.is-disabled):hover {
  background: linear-gradient(90deg, #2991f1 0%, #7b4aff 100%);
}
.progress-bar[data-v-4849b216] {
  position: fixed;
  top: 0;
  left: 0;
  height: 0.015625rem;
  background: linear-gradient(90deg, #7b4aff, #2991f1);
  z-index: 9999;
  transition: width 0.2s;
}
.ZPanel {
  position: relative;
  overflow: auto;
}
.ZPanel .handle {
  opacity: 0;
  background-color: transparent;
  position: absolute;
}
.ZPanel .handle:hover {
  background-color: transparent;
  opacity: 1;
}
.ZPanel .resizing {
  opacity: 1;
}
.ZPanel .resizable-left {
  top: 0;
  left: 0;
  bottom: 0;
  width: 0.01041667rem;
  border-left: 0.01041667rem solid #2991F1;
  cursor: ew-resize;
}
.ZPanel .resizable-right {
  top: 0;
  right: 0;
  bottom: 0;
  width: 0.01041667rem;
  border-right: 0.01041667rem solid #2991F1;
  cursor: ew-resize;
}
.ZPanel .resizable-top {
  top: 0;
  left: 0;
  right: 0;
  height: 0.01041667rem;
  border-top: 0.01041667rem solid #2991F1;
  cursor: ns-resize;
}
.ZPanel .resizable-bottom {
  left: 0;
  right: 0;
  bottom: 0;
  height: 0.01041667rem;
  border-bottom: 0.01041667rem solid #2991F1;
  cursor: ns-resize;
}
.ZDialog {
  z-index: 999;
  position: absolute;
  top: 0.78125rem;
  left: 50%;
  transform: translateX(-50%);
  background-color: #131313;
  width: 3.02083333rem;
  display: flex;
  flex-direction: column;
  user-select: none;
}
.ZDialog .contentBody {
  flex: 1;
  overflow: auto;
  display: flex;
  align-items: center;
  justify-content: center;
}

/* 动画样式 */
.dialog-enter-active {
  animation: dialog-fade-in 0.3s ease;
  transition: transform 0.3s ease;
}
.dialog-leave-active {
  animation: dialog-fade-out 0.3s ease;
  transition: transform 0.3s ease;
}
@keyframes dialog-fade-in {
from {
    opacity: 0;
    transform: scale(0.7);
}
to {
    opacity: 1;
    transform: scale(1);
}
}
@keyframes dialog-fade-out {
from {
    opacity: 1;
    transform: scale(1);
}
to {
    opacity: 0;
    transform: scale(0.7);
}
}
